In the Tx mapping function if a DMA error occurred then the unwind of
previously mapped sections would improperly check an unsigned int if
it was less than zero.  Changed the index variable to signed to avoid
the error.

acl.h
/*
  File: fs/ext4/acl.h

  (C) 2001 Andreas Gruenbacher, <a.gruenbacher@computer.org>
*/

#include <linux/posix_acl_xattr.h>

#define EXT4_ACL_VERSION	0x0001

typedef struct {
	__le16		e_tag;
	__le16		e_perm;
	__le32		e_id;
} ext4_acl_entry;

typedef struct {
	__le16		e_tag;
	__le16		e_perm;
} ext4_acl_entry_short;

typedef struct {
	__le32		a_version;
} ext4_acl_header;

static inline size_t ext4_acl_size(int count)
{
	if (count <= 4) {
		return sizeof(ext4_acl_header) +
		       count * sizeof(ext4_acl_entry_short);
	} else {
		return sizeof(ext4_acl_header) +
		       4 * sizeof(ext4_acl_entry_short) +
		       (count - 4) * sizeof(ext4_acl_entry);
	}
}

static inline int ext4_acl_count(size_t size)
{
	ssize_t s;
	size -= sizeof(ext4_acl_header);
	s = size - 4 * sizeof(ext4_acl_entry_short);
	if (s < 0) {
		if (size % sizeof(ext4_acl_entry_short))
			return -1;
		return size / sizeof(ext4_acl_entry_short);
	} else {
		if (s % sizeof(ext4_acl_entry))
			return -1;
		return s / sizeof(ext4_acl_entry) + 4;
	}
}

#ifdef CONFIG_EXT4_FS_POSIX_ACL

/* acl.c */
extern int ext4_check_acl(struct inode *, int);
extern int ext4_acl_chmod(struct inode *);
extern int ext4_init_acl(handle_t *, struct inode *, struct inode *);

#else  /* CONFIG_EXT4_FS_POSIX_ACL */
#include <linux/sched.h>
#define ext4_check_acl NULL

static inline int
ext4_acl_chmod(struct inode *inode)
{
	return 0;
}

static inline int
ext4_init_acl(handle_t *handle, struct inode *inode, struct inode *dir)
{
	return 0;
}
#endif  /* CONFIG_EXT4_FS_POSIX_ACL */
